/**
 * Autogenerated by Thrift
 *
 * DO NOT EDIT UNLESS YOU ARE SURE THAT YOU KNOW WHAT YOU ARE DOING
 */
package com.evernote.edam.userstore;

import java.util.List;
import java.util.ArrayList;
import java.util.Map;
import java.util.HashMap;
import java.util.Set;
import java.util.HashSet;

import com.evernote.thrift.*;
import com.evernote.thrift.protocol.*;

/**
 *  This structure describes a collection of bootstrap profiles.
 * 
*
profiles:
*
* List of one or more bootstrap profiles, in descending * preference order. *
*
*/ public class BootstrapInfo implements TBase, java.io.Serializable, Cloneable { private static final TStruct STRUCT_DESC = new TStruct("BootstrapInfo"); private static final TField PROFILES_FIELD_DESC = new TField("profiles", TType.LIST, (short)1); private List profiles; // isset id assignments public BootstrapInfo() { } public BootstrapInfo( List profiles) { this(); this.profiles = profiles; } /** * Performs a deep copy on other. */ public BootstrapInfo(BootstrapInfo other) { if (other.isSetProfiles()) { List __this__profiles = new ArrayList(); for (BootstrapProfile other_element : other.profiles) { __this__profiles.add(new BootstrapProfile(other_element)); } this.profiles = __this__profiles; } } public BootstrapInfo deepCopy() { return new BootstrapInfo(this); } public void clear() { this.profiles = null; } public int getProfilesSize() { return (this.profiles == null) ? 0 : this.profiles.size(); } public java.util.Iterator getProfilesIterator() { return (this.profiles == null) ? null : this.profiles.iterator(); } public void addToProfiles(BootstrapProfile elem) { if (this.profiles == null) { this.profiles = new ArrayList(); } this.profiles.add(elem); } public List getProfiles() { return this.profiles; } public void setProfiles(List profiles) { this.profiles = profiles; } public void unsetProfiles() { this.profiles = null; } /** Returns true if field profiles is set (has been asigned a value) and false otherwise */ public boolean isSetProfiles() { return this.profiles != null; } public void setProfilesIsSet(boolean value) { if (!value) { this.profiles = null; } } @Override public boolean equals(Object that) { if (that == null) return false; if (that instanceof BootstrapInfo) return this.equals((BootstrapInfo)that); return false; } public boolean equals(BootstrapInfo that) { if (that == null) return false; boolean this_present_profiles = true && this.isSetProfiles(); boolean that_present_profiles = true && that.isSetProfiles(); if (this_present_profiles || that_present_profiles) { if (!(this_present_profiles && that_present_profiles)) return false; if (!this.profiles.equals(that.profiles)) return false; } return true; } @Override public int hashCode() { return 0; } public int compareTo(BootstrapInfo other) { if (!getClass().equals(other.getClass())) { return getClass().getName().compareTo(other.getClass().getName()); } int lastComparison = 0; BootstrapInfo typedOther = (BootstrapInfo)other; lastComparison = Boolean.valueOf(isSetProfiles()).compareTo(typedOther.isSetProfiles()); if (lastComparison != 0) { return lastComparison; } if (isSetProfiles()) { lastComparison = TBaseHelper.compareTo(this.profiles, typedOther.profiles); if (lastComparison != 0) { return lastComparison; } } return 0; } public void read(TProtocol iprot) throws TException { TField field; iprot.readStructBegin(); while (true) { field = iprot.readFieldBegin(); if (field.type == TType.STOP) { break; } switch (field.id) { case 1: // PROFILES if (field.type == TType.LIST) { { TList _list0 = iprot.readListBegin(); this.profiles = new ArrayList(_list0.size); for (int _i1 = 0; _i1 < _list0.size; ++_i1) { BootstrapProfile _elem2; _elem2 = new BootstrapProfile(); _elem2.read(iprot); this.profiles.add(_elem2); } iprot.readListEnd(); } } else { TProtocolUtil.skip(iprot, field.type); } break; default: TProtocolUtil.skip(iprot, field.type); } iprot.readFieldEnd(); } iprot.readStructEnd(); validate(); } public void write(TProtocol oprot) throws TException { validate(); oprot.writeStructBegin(STRUCT_DESC); if (this.profiles != null) { oprot.writeFieldBegin(PROFILES_FIELD_DESC); { oprot.writeListBegin(new TList(TType.STRUCT, this.profiles.size())); for (BootstrapProfile _iter3 : this.profiles) { _iter3.write(oprot); } oprot.writeListEnd(); } oprot.writeFieldEnd(); } oprot.writeFieldStop(); oprot.writeStructEnd(); } @Override public String toString() { StringBuilder sb = new StringBuilder("BootstrapInfo("); boolean first = true; sb.append("profiles:"); if (this.profiles == null) { sb.append("null"); } else { sb.append(this.profiles); } first = false; sb.append(")"); return sb.toString(); } public void validate() throws TException { // check for required fields if (!isSetProfiles()) { throw new TProtocolException("Required field 'profiles' is unset! Struct:" + toString()); } } }
